The PWM HW is actually the same for all SoCs supported so far. A specific compatible is needed only because the clock sources of the PWMs are hard-coded in the driver. It is better to have the clock source described in DT but this changes the bindings so a new compatible must be introduced. When all supported platform have migrated to the new compatible, support for the legacy ones may be removed from the driver. Adding a callback to setup the clock will also make it easier to add support for the new PWM HW found in a1, s4, c3 and t7 SoC families.
